Annual sold price in LS10 3, 1995–2026 — mean (blue) and median (terracotta). The median is the typical sale; a wide gap to the mean means a few high-value sales pull the average up. 2026 is a part year (30 sales so far). Hover a point for both figures. Source: HM Land Registry Price Paid.
